Behind The Lens

Location

This photo was taken in London, UK, in Richmond Park.

Time

It was later afternoon in late summer.

Lighting

Just totally natural light, however there was very little sun, so the light is diffused which gives a nice result.

Equipment

Just a camera - this is a handheld photo. The deer do not stay in one place for a long time. You have to be ready to take the photo.

Inspiration

I am a wildlife photographer, animals are my passion. I waited for the deer to look at me almost, and then I took the photo.

Editing

A simple small crop. Otherwise just what you normally to improve the light a bit.

In my camera bag

Nowadays, I have my Nikon Z7-II with a 200-500 zoom and a Nikon D850 with a 28-300 zoom. A tripod, some filters, a hand held flash light, a macro lens, and some munchies. :-)

Feedback

Patience, and don't be afraid to put your camera on Manual with auto ISO set to max about 2000.
